What is the Michigan FOIA Request Form?

The Michigan FOIA Request Form is an essential tool for individuals seeking to access public records under the Michigan Freedom of Information Act. This form plays a vital role in promoting public transparency and accountability. It empowers requestors to specify the records they wish to obtain, ensuring transparency in government operations.
The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) is designed to provide citizens with the right to request access to government-held information. The requestor's role involves accurately filling out the form, detailing the specific records sought, and following the requisite protocols to ensure a valid submission.

Key Features of the Michigan FOIA Request Form

The Michigan FOIA Request Form includes several key features designed to facilitate the public records request process. It contains fillable fields where the requestor can input personal contact details and a detailed description of the records being sought.
  • Checkboxes for selecting preferred delivery methods of the requested information
  • Options for requesting various types of media, including digital formats and certified copies
  • Discount provisions for nonprofit organizations and individuals who may be financially challenged

Any individual or entity can submit a Michigan FOIA Request as long as they provide the necessary information about the records they seek. This includes citizens, organizations, and businesses.
Processing times for FOIA Requests can vary but typically take around 5 business days. The agency may request an extension if needed, which could increase the timeframe.
Generally, no supporting documents are required for a FOIA Request. However, including identification or verification of your identity may be necessary for certain records.
Yes, you can submit the Michigan FOIA Request Form electronically via pdfFiller. Make sure to check the agency's submission policies for specific electronic submission guidelines.
Avoid leaving fields blank, providing vague descriptions of the records, and failing to sign the form. Clear and complete information will enhance the processing of your request.
Fees may apply depending on the nature of the records requested. Typically, charges cover reproduction costs, so check with the agency for specific details on their fee schedule.
If your FOIA Request is denied, you will receive a written explanation. You can appeal the decision, so ensure to follow the instructions provided in the denial notice.
